View source
class qtip_views_handler_field_tooltip extends views_handler_field_custom {
function option_definition() {
$options = parent::option_definition();
$options['qtip_views']['title'] = array(
'default' => '',
'translatable' => TRUE,
);
$options['qtip_views']['text'] = array(
'default' => '',
'translatable' => TRUE,
);
$options['qtip_views']['hide_if_equal'] = array(
'default' => TRUE,
'translatable' => TRUE,
);
$options['qtip_views']['instance'] = array(
'default' => '',
'translatable' => FALSE,
);
return $options;
}
function options_form(&$form, &$form_state) {
// First get the basic form fields (label, textfield, exclude display)...
parent::options_form($form, $form_state);
// ... then build our custom fields
$form['qtip_views'] = array(
'#type' => 'fieldset',
'#title' => t('qTip settings'),
'#collapsible' => FALSE,
);
$form['qtip_views']['title'] = array(
'#type' => 'textfield',
'#title' => t('Title'),
'#description' => t('The title to give the tooltip.'),
'#default_value' => $this->options['qtip_views']['title'],
);
$form['qtip_views']['text'] = array(
'#type' => 'textarea',
'#title' => t('Text'),
'#description' => t('The text to display for the tooltip of this field. You may include HTML. You may enter data from this view as per the "Replacement patterns".'),
'#default_value' => $this->options['qtip_views']['text'],
);
$form['qtip_views']['hide_if_equal'] = array(
'#type' => 'checkbox',
'#title' => t('Hide the tooltip if equal to the text'),
'#default_value' => $this->options['qtip_views']['hide_if_equal'],
);
$form['qtip_views']['instance'] = qtip_fetch_instances_field($this->options['qtip_views']['instance']);
}
function render_text($alter) {
// If available, render the content, passing it to upstream renderer...
if ($content = parent::render_text($alter)) {
// ... then render the tooltip.
$tokens = $this
->get_render_tokens($alter);
$title = str_replace(array_keys($tokens), array_values($tokens), $this->options['qtip_views']['title']);
$tooltip = str_replace(array_keys($tokens), array_values($tokens), $this->options['qtip_views']['text']);
if ($tooltip === '' || $this->options['qtip_views']['hide_if_equal'] && $content == $tooltip) {
return $content;
}
else {
$theme_variables = array(
'content' => $content,
'title' => $title,
'tooltip' => $tooltip,
'instance' => $this->options['qtip_views']['instance'],
);
return theme('qtip', $theme_variables);
}
}
}
}
